Everyone has heard of fashion, but not everyone can define what fashion is? Fashion is a style that prevails for a very short time, at most a few years, and often only one season, as is the case in the clothing industry. Fashion is invented by a single person or a group of people who have a vision for a given field. An example would be fashion related to clothing. Although fashion can concern not only clothing, but also various things, such as hairstyles, makeup, behavior, worldview, conduct, lifestyle, etc.

The influence of media on fashion
Fashion is most widely spread by the media. Very often, what is visible on the screens of the phone, television, or computer or in the pages of newspapers, very quickly gains supporters. People start to model themselves on a given person, e.g. a movie hero or a star of the stage, an influencer. As was the case in the past with the career of the famous French fashion designer Christian Dior. The founder of one of the largest fashion houses in the world. Or Giorgio Armani, who gained fame by sewing clothes for Hollywood stars. Movie stars, taking on the role of movie heroes and dressing in clothes designed by Armani, were pure advertising for the clothing designed by Armani. This quickly made the designer famous and introduced a new fashion for men's clothing, e.g. tailored men's suits. The resulting fashion trend moved away from wide trousers and hanging men's jackets in favor of tailored men's clothing.
The famous fashion designers of that time did not forget about women either, wanting to create businesswomen out of them. Because it was a time of great economic development in many countries. In order for women to be more easily able to match the male population in business and career, suits were also designed for them. It was a garment consisting of trousers and a jacket, but less fitted than a man's suit. A woman who looked like this was supposed to fight for equal rights in terms of gaining managerial positions in corporations or gain a better image by becoming a businesswoman.

Style and fashion
In fashion design, the most important thing is to sense the moment. That is, to notice what is in demand. In the times after World War II, there was a demand for freedom, liberty and diversity. A little later, when the destroyed countries were rebuilt and the economy began to develop, there was a need to create an image of a strong, serious man who knew what he wanted. It was necessary to show one's strength and determination in the fight for, for example, managerial positions. That is why tough women's fashion was created, modelled on men's clothing. Today, fashion also changes constantly. Only style remains constant. Because if someone has their own style, they rarely deviate from it. Because style is an unchanging thing, unlike fashion.
